How to Become a Machine Learning Engineer in India

This career graph outlines potential trajectories to become and advance as a Machine Learning Engineer in the vibrant and rapidly growing Indian technology market. It encompasses entry-level roles, crucial mid-level stepping stones, the target role, and advanced leadership and architectural positions, reflecting typical progression paths and salary expectations in India.

Career Progression

Entry Level

Data Analyst

Analyzes data to extract insights, create reports, and support business decisions. Develops foundational skills in data manipulation, statistical analysis, and basic programming relevant for data science.

₹4,00,000 - ₹8,00,000 per annum · 1-3 years

Skills: SQL, Python (Pandas, NumPy), Excel, Data Visualization (Tableau, Power BI), Statistical Analysis

Junior Data Scientist

Works on smaller-scale data science projects, assisting in data preprocessing, exploratory data analysis, model building, and evaluation. Gains initial experience with various ML algorithms and programming.

₹6,00,000 - ₹10,00,000 per annum · 1-2 years

Skills: Python (Scikit-learn, TensorFlow/PyTorch basics), Statistics, Machine Learning Fundamentals, SQL, Data Modeling

Software Engineer

Develops and maintains software applications. This role provides a strong foundation in programming, data structures, algorithms, and software engineering best practices, which are crucial for building robust ML systems.

₹5,00,000 - ₹10,00,000 per annum · 1-3 years

Skills: Python, Java/C++, Data Structures & Algorithms, Object-Oriented Programming, Version Control (Git), System Design Basics

Mid Level

Data Scientist

Applies advanced statistical methods and machine learning techniques to solve complex business problems. Responsible for end-to-end project execution, from data exploration and model development to initial deployment considerations.

₹8,00,000 - ₹18,00,000 per annum · 2-4 years

Skills: Advanced Machine Learning, Deep Learning (TensorFlow/PyTorch), Statistical Modeling, Feature Engineering, Experiment Design, Cloud Platforms (AWS/Azure/GCP)

Target Role

Machine Learning Engineer

Designs, builds, and maintains scalable machine learning systems in production. Focuses on the engineering aspects of ML, including model deployment, MLOps, and integrating ML solutions into existing software architectures.

₹10,00,000 - ₹25,00,000 per annum · 3-5 years

Skills: MLOps, Model Deployment, Scalable ML Systems, Distributed Computing (Spark, Hadoop), Deep Learning Frameworks (TensorFlow, PyTorch), Cloud ML Services (SageMaker, Vertex AI)

Senior / Leadership

Senior Machine Learning Engineer

Leads complex ML projects, mentors junior engineers, and takes ownership of critical ML infrastructure and model development. Drives technical design, architectural decisions, and contributes to the long-term ML strategy.

₹18,00,000 - ₹35,00,000 per annum · 3-5 years

Skills: System Design for ML, Advanced MLOps, Distributed Machine Learning, Performance Optimization, Team Leadership (technical), Domain Expertise

Lead Machine Learning Engineer / ML Manager

Manages a team of ML engineers, setting technical direction, project goals, and ensuring successful delivery of ML initiatives. Balances technical depth with leadership, project management, and people development.

₹25,00,000 - ₹50,00,000 per annum · 4-6 years

Skills: Team Management, Project Leadership, Technical Strategy, Resource Planning, Mentorship, Stakeholder Communication

Principal Machine Learning Engineer / ML Architect

Defines the long-term technical vision and architecture for ML systems across an organization or multiple product lines. Solves the most challenging technical problems, drives innovation, and influences product strategy with ML capabilities.

₹35,00,000 - ₹80,00,000+ per annum · 5+ years

Skills: Strategic Technical Vision, Enterprise ML Architecture, Innovation & Research, Cross-functional Leadership, Advanced Research & Publications, Deep Expertise in ML Paradigms
